For signs that ducts may need cleaning in Woodfin, local conditions matter. Woodfin's rapid development — including the new Woodfin Greenway and river amenities — is attracting both new construction and renovations of older homes. New builds along the French Broad River need properly sized systems that account for the river valley's higher humidity. Reynolds Mountain's hilltop properties face different conditions than the valley floor homes near Riverside Drive, often requiring different HVAC approaches within the same small community.

Woodfin's proximity to the French Broad River means higher humidity in summer months. If your home is within a quarter mile of the river, consider a whole-home dehumidifier to supplement your AC system — it reduces the cooling load and prevents the clammy feeling that occurs when AC alone handles dehumidification. Look for Evidence, Not a Calendar

Air ducts do not need cleaning simply because a certain number of years has passed. The strongest reasons to inspect are visible debris blowing from supply registers, substantial deposits inside accessible runs, evidence of rodents or insects, apparent biological growth, or heavy dust left by construction. Quality Comfort helps homeowners distinguish those real warning signs from normal dust on a return grille.

Pay Attention When the Blower Starts

A musty odor, a visible puff from a register, or dust that returns unusually quickly can justify a closer look. These symptoms still have more than one possible source: a wet drain pan, dirty filter, return leak, or dusty carpet may imitate a duct problem. We trace the pattern before recommending work.

Check What You Can Safely See

Turn the system off, remove an accessible register, and use a flashlight without reaching into the duct. Photograph what you see. Do not disturb suspected mold, old insulation, or unknown materials. A picture and a description of recent renovations, pests, or water events give our team a useful starting point.

Get an Honest Recommendation

If cleaning is warranted, we explain the scope and what it can realistically improve. If the ducts look normal, we may recommend a filter change, maintenance, sealing, or no immediate work at all.
